City Council Minutes

CITY OF GRANDVILLE

REGULAR CITY COUNCIL MEETING

MONDAY, FEBRUARY 23, 2009

 

The Grandville City Council Regular Meeting of February 23, 2009 was called to order by Mayor James Buck at 7:00 pm.

 

The Acting Clerk called the roll.  Present were Council Members Ken Gates, Randal Gelderloos, Steve Maas, Joshua Meringa, Carole Pettijohn, Dick Richards, and Mayor James Buck.   Absent:  None.

 

Also attending:  Tammy Aue, Treasurer/Finance Director; Randy Kraker, City Attorney; Kenneth Krombeen, City Manager; Marci Poley, Acting Clerk; Dennis Santo, Police Chief; and Jim Uyl, Commercial Assessor.

 

Rev. Tony Meyer, Ivanrest Christian Reformed Church gave the invocation; and was followed by the Pledge of Allegiance.

 

Motion made by Council Member Maas, supported by Council Member Gates, to approve the February 23, 2009 agenda as presented. The motion was APPROVED.

 

Motion made by Council Member Meringa, supported by Council Member Maas, to waive the reading of the minutes of the Regular Meeting of  February 9, 2009 and to approve as presented. The motion was APPROVED.

 

Motion made by Council Member Gates, supported by Council Member Pettijohn, that Fiscal Year 2008-2009 bills totaling $425,472.06 as presented by the City Manager, be allowed and authorize the Treasurer to pay the same. The motion was unanimously APPROVED by roll call vote.

CITY MANAGER’S

City Manager Krombeen explained that negotiations of the Jail Per Diem and Arrest Processing Fees have been completed. The result is that the fees to the cities of Grand Rapids, Grandville, Kentwood, Walker, and Wyoming will be reduced by 25%. The Jail Per Diem rate would be reduced from $47.80 to $35.85 and the Arrest Processing fee from $20.08 to $15.06. There is no set term for the agreements but provision for unilateral termination by any party by 90 day notice prior to the start of the County’s fiscal year. Motion made by Council Member Gates, supported by Council Member Gelderloos, to enter into the Jail Per Diem Fee and Arrest Processing Fee agreements substantially in the form submitted. The motion was unanimously APPROVED by roll call vote.
